Nitrile Gloves Australia: Importance in Health & Safety
Nitrile gloves are a critical component in health and safety protocols across numerous industries in Australia. Renowned for their strength and protective properties, nitrile gloves Australia are especially favoured in settings where maintaining hygiene and safety is paramount. Nitrile gloves are crafted from a synthetic rubber compound, which provides superior resistance to punctures and chemicals compared to other materials like latex and vinyl. This makes them ideal for environments such as healthcare, food processing, and chemical handling, where reliable protection is crucial.

Comparing Nitrile with Other Materials
Nitrile gloves stand out due to their high resistance to punctures and chemicals, which makes them particularly suitable for environments requiring robust protection.
- In contrast, latex gloves offer superior elasticity and tactile sensitivity, making them ideal for tasks necessitating fine motor skills.
- However, latex gloves pose a risk for individuals with latex allergies; an issue nitrile gloves effectively address with their hypoallergenic properties.
- Vinyl gloves, while generally more affordable, tend to offer less durability and chemical resistance compared to nitrile and latex options.
- Additionally, vinyl gloves may not fit as snugly, potentially compromising precision in tasks requiring detailed work.
- Each glove material has distinct attributes that cater to specific needs, making the choice dependent on the application and the necessary level of protection and sensitivity.

Safety Standards and Regulations in Australia
Australia mandates strict compliance with safety standards and regulations to ensure the quality and effectiveness of gloves used in various industries. The Therapeutic Goods Administration (TGA) oversees the regulation of medical gloves, requiring manufacturers to adhere to rigorous testing protocols for factors such as puncture resistance, tensile strength, and barrier integrity.
This regulatory oversight ensures that gloves meet the necessary benchmarks for safety and performance, protecting users from potential hazards. In non-medical sectors, standards set by the Australian Standards (AS) and the International Organization for Standardization (ISO) apply, providing guidelines for industrial gloves’ production and quality assurance.
